Purchased the BV1901TS on December 17, 2018, for $129.49. On, or about, August 28, 2019 it suffered a catastrophic failure. Upon plugging in the unit, I heard a brief, unusual, “buzzing sound” coming from inside the unit. Upon depressing the switch, I heard the buzzing sound again and the unit smelled hot. I stood with the unit and noticed that it was not heating water. The unit was unplugged and Bonavita was contacted via their website’s warranty section, describing the issue and answering their detailed questions. On September 13, 2019, I finally heard from Bonavita (via email) and they stated that they would be sending a new unit to me. On September 17, 2019, I received word from FedEx that my shipment was on it’s way from “Espresso Supply” in Woodinville Washington. On September 24, 2019, I finally got a replacement unit. Upon inspecting the old unit, I discovered that all of the interior screw heads (heating unit, circuit board, wire retainer, etc) were rusted severely. The metal water supply tube was showing signs of rust. The tension clips, that secured the water lines, were also completely rusted. The connection, between the heater wire and the heater, was burnt to the point of disintegrating the female connector when touched. The male connector (blade) had residual metal stuck to it and a corner of the blade burnt off. This unit had never been even close to being submerged in water as it had only been hand cleaned. It also was descaled, according to the manufacturer’s recommendations, on a regular basis. When brewing coffee, the unit was pulled out from under the overhanging cabinet, so as to have ample air flow for the steam coming through the top to escape, and it was allowed to cool before placing back under the cabinet. Having never purchased a coffee maker of this price, and theoretical value, we went to great lengths to maintain it. This unit had worked flawlessly, from the time we first received it, until it failed. However, looking inside, there is an obvious issue with internal moisture, around the circuit board and heating unit, as well as very low quality internal parts being used in this unit’s construction. This is a definite safety/quality issue, and fire hazard, that needs to be addressed by the manufacturer.

I bought this coffee maker for about $105 in December 2019 after doing a lot of online research. I have been happy with the taste of the coffee it made but after a couple of years it started to stop during the brewing cycle. When that occurred I was always able to get it going again by running multiple cleaning cycles. (I never understood why all the cleanings were needed since we do not have hard water and always use filtered water for brewing.) Today, however, it stopped mid-cycle and also had the dreaded burnt electrical smell indicating something major had failed. When I took it apart I found that one of the power wires had burnt up where it connects to the circuit board and partially melted a relay on the board. I have not been able to find the circuit board anywhere online to purchase so I will be tossing the entire coffee maker into the trash - what a waste! I don't think that I will be buying another one at the current price!
